Directions for Use

Suggested use: Ages 2-12: Take 1/2 teaspoon daily. Swirl bottle gently under warm water to mix, if needed.

Warnings & Precautions

Caution: This product contains honey and as such it should not be used by children under 12 months of age. As with any dietary supplement, advise your healthcare professional of the use of this product if your children have a medical condition or are taking medication. Keep out of reach of children.
